刚才想把web项目直接部署到iis上调试的时候遇到这么一个错误:“HTTP 错误 500.19 - Internal Server Error”,于是找了一下相关资料,发现是没有“Everyone”用户导致的,查了一下自己的网站目录,确实是这么一回事,于是在网站根目录上加了“Everyone”用户,并且附于修改权限(我是把所有权限都给了)IIS中右键网站,点击“浏览”,可以正常访问了(localhos://...的这种方式)。 感觉是我对IIS的不了解才导致这种没文化的错误发生的,罪过罪过(>﹏<)。下面是网上找的资料,简单归纳一下做备忘!
一、错误摘要
HTTP 错误 500.19 - Internal Server Error
无法访问请求的页面,因为该页的相关配置数据无效。
详细错误信息
模块 IIS Web Core
通知 未知
处理程序 尚未确定
二、解决方法
到站点目录的属性、安全标签,添加用户(Everyone),并给修改权限